How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Trenton?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Trenton Studio Apartments | $1,382 | $922 | $3,290 |
Trenton 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,277 | $699 | $3,447 |
Trenton 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,636 | $825 | $3,189 |
Trenton 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,891 | $1,150 | $4,241 |
Trenton 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,550 | $1,500 | $1,600 |

Largest Available Trenton and Nearby 2 Bedroom Apartments
The largest available 2 Bedroom apartment unit in Trenton, AL is found at Waterford Square Apartment Homes in the South Central Huntsville neighborhood and is 1,402 square feet priced from $1,149. Ascent Jones Valley has the second largest 2 Bedroom, which is sized at 1,390 square feet and currently listed start at $1,010. Here is today’s list of the largest available 2 Bedroom units in Trenton:

Cheapest Available Trenton and Nearby 2 Bedroom Apartments
As of May 11, 2025 the lowest priced 2 Bedroom apartment unit in Trenton, AL is the 2B/1B Model starting from $825 at Hunters Ridge in the South Central Huntsville neighborhood. The second most affordable Trenton 2 Bedroom is the 2 Bed 1 Bathroom Model at Fern Parc starting at $899 in the Indian Creek neighborhood. The average price for all 2 Bedroom apartments in Trenton is currently $1,636. Here is today’s list of the cheapest available 2 Bedroom options in Trenton:
